#ifndef MOJO_PUBLIC_CPP_BINDINGS_TESTS_ROUTER_TEST_UTIL_H_
#define MOJO_PUBLIC_CPP_BINDINGS_TESTS_ROUTER_TEST_UTIL_H_
#include <stdint.h>
#include <string>
#include "base/callback.h"
#include "mojo/public/cpp/bindings/message.h"
namespace mojo {
namespace test {
class MessageQueue;
void AllocRequestMessage(uint32_t name, const char* text, Message* message);
void AllocResponseMessage(uint32_t name,
const char* text,
uint64_t request_id,
Message* message);
class MessageAccumulator : public MessageReceiver {
public:
MessageAccumulator(MessageQueue* queue,
const base::Closure& closure = base::Closure());
~MessageAccumulator() override;
bool Accept(Message* message) override;
private:
MessageQueue* queue_;
base::Closure closure_;
};
class ResponseGenerator : public MessageReceiverWithResponderStatus {
public:
ResponseGenerator();
bool Accept(Message* message) override;
bool AcceptWithResponder(
Message* message,
std::unique_ptr<MessageReceiverWithStatus> responder) override;
bool SendResponse(uint32_t name,
uint64_t request_id,
const char* request_string,
MessageReceiver* responder);
};
class LazyResponseGenerator : public ResponseGenerator {
public:
explicit LazyResponseGenerator(
const base::Closure& closure = base::Closure());
~LazyResponseGenerator() override;
bool AcceptWithResponder(
Message* message,
std::unique_ptr<MessageReceiverWithStatus> responder) override;
bool has_responder() const { return !!responder_; }
bool responder_is_valid() const { return responder_->IsConnected(); }
void set_closure(const base::Closure& closure) { closure_ = closure; }
// Sends the response and delete the responder.
void CompleteWithResponse() { Complete(true); }
// Deletes the responder without sending a response.
void CompleteWithoutResponse() { Complete(false); }
private:
// Completes the request handling by deleting responder_. Optionally
// also sends a response.
void Complete(bool send_response);
std::unique_ptr<MessageReceiverWithStatus> responder_;
uint32_t name_;
uint64_t request_id_;
std::string request_string_;
base::Closure closure_;
};
} // namespace test
} // namespace mojo
#endif // MOJO_PUBLIC_CPP_BINDINGS_TESTS_ROUTER_TEST_UTIL_H_
